A Cognitive-Based Investigation of P3 Students’ Learning of Chinese Grammar in Singapore Bilingual Context: The Case of Compound Sentences

  • Fangqiong Zhan,
  • Zhenying Hong

摘要

This study conducts a cognitive-based investigation of P3 students’ learning of Chinese grammar in Singapore bilingual context. We observe the current teaching approach, identifies the gap between the learning outcomes and teaching goals, and conducts the pedagogical experiment to fill in the gap by incorporating the cognitive-based practices. The experimental findings confirm the hypothesis that aligning cognitive-based practices with the cognitive processes of the human brain leads to more effective classroom instruction and learning activities, fostering the development of students’ proficiency in Chinese.
